原文:【Redis】redis分頁查詢理解

偶然在代碼中發現一個接口,接口定義說是分頁查詢,但邏輯實現是Redis。不太理解,Redis怎么分頁 后來看到一篇文章,然后了解了。 Zrevrange實現 通過SortedSet的zrevrange topicId page page perPage指令可以實現分頁功能。 Redis Zrevrange 命令 返回有序集中指定區間內的成員,通過索引,分數從高到底。 參考:Redis Zrevra ...

2018-10-09 11:19 0 9002 推薦指數:

查看詳情

分頁查詢redis

問題 我在做論壇的是時候遇到了如下的問題。論壇里可以有很多的主題topic,每個topic對應到很多回復reply。現在要查詢某個topic下按照replyTime升序排列的第pageNo頁的reply,每頁pageSize個reply。 reply是存放在mysql中的。以前的實現是利用 ...

Fri May 06 23:01:00 CST 2016 1 20217
Redis中進行分頁排序查詢【轉】

Redis是一個高效的內存數據庫,它支持包括String、List、Set、SortedSet和Hash等數據類型的存儲,在Redis中通常根據數據的key查詢其value值,Redis沒有條件查詢,在面對一些需要分頁或排序的場景時(如評論,時間線),Redis就不太好不處理了。 前段時間在項目 ...

Sat Jul 18 19:37:00 CST 2020 0 1095
redis分頁

原理:得到的數組用foreach遍歷lpush到key中,然后通過lrange里的后面兩個參數獲取key里面的數據 db.class.php redis.php ...

Tue Oct 18 01:43:00 CST 2016 0 2014
使用redis的zset實現高效分頁查詢(附完整代碼)

一、需求 移動端系統里有用戶和文章,文章可設置權限對部分用戶開放。現要實現的功能是,用戶瀏覽自己能看的最新文章,並可以上滑分頁查看。 二、數據庫表設計 涉及到的數據庫表有:用戶表TbUser、文章表TbArticle、用戶可見文章表TbUserArticle ...

Mon Jan 13 06:43:00 CST 2020 7 24086
REDIS 分頁緩存的實現

1、基於列表的分頁緩存實現     以下內容轉載自 NoSQL數據庫入門與實踐(基於MongoDB、Redis) 劉瑜 劉勝松 分頁緩存的背景  分頁緩存的使用需求 總結   1、REDIS的LIST內部 ...

Fri Dec 10 01:43:00 CST 2021 0 832
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M